TXN limitations

  • special characters not displayed in suggestions (CR, non breakable spaces…)
  • we loose suggestion/history while translating offline
  • proofreading is not useful, the team coordinator should decide either the maintainer DL proofread only or not (team specific, they don't need to know)
  • sorting resources is broken, scroll bar is slow
  • the lock time is to small, there could be a "unlock request" sending a notification to the coordinator and the locker
  • on the translators credits (Last Translator gettext header), the maintainer appears, which is wierd
  • we can't easily add a whole project to a release (see fedora-docs, that's huge and unmaintainable (if new files appears, we don't know)
  • No FAS login (OpenID?)
